Introduction:
A Help Desk Team Leader is a person who supervises the activities of all contractors who are members of the help desk team, to ensure that they deliver excellent customer service, and provide customer guidance. Help Desk Team Leads makes it a priority to meet all customer expectations and keeps track of all performance indexes which include incoming calls, outgoing calls, and open aged calls. As a leader, you are responsible for creating and implementing support for all customers’ queries, assessing team performance, and redefines customer services with the support of management. In order to ensure the general growth of the organization, you will collaborate with the business manager(s) to brainstorm ideas and strategies to enhance good customer experience in the organization. Initiate strategies through which you can obtain customer feedback on service delivery, rate customer perception about the organization in order to determine their strengths and weaknesses and further strengthen loose ends for better service delivery. Provide detailed and comprehensive technical support to customers, particularly in handling escalated and more complex calls as well as calls requiring a supervisory perspective and judgement. Report all activities and observations to the service desk manager and assist in finding resolutions to all outstanding issues. Utilize expertise in order to mentor and groom less-experienced members in the help desk team. Train help desk team members, assign tasks and evaluate performance to determine their level of learning. Provide training and support for the technical requirements of the team members, as necessary. Ensure proper staffing levels of team members to ensure proper coverage. Analyze reports and performance data to ensure technical team is performing productively and efficiently.
Responsibilities:
- Gives specific directions to the technical desk team members to enable them to meet specific customer needs.
- Creates and manages both intra and inter teamwork processes that will boost the level of productivity, enhance excellence in communication, and monitor the level of service delivery in order to determine areas of lapses.
- Administers effective frontline desk assistance to customers where inquiries are beyond the knowledge of the help desk team members.
- Implements a central problem management route for information management users to handle queries and complaints.
- Showcases level of expertise by providing satisfactory explanations and solutions to customer questions and issues to gain their confidence.
- Take measures of crisis management to control all effects that may arise from customer problems and complaints to avoid escalation.
- Administers the initial and on-going team training including direct training and making arrangements for team members to receive training on the latest and best practices in handling help desk-related issues.
- Keeps clean records of all activities in the help desk department and present them to management upon request for evaluation.
- Create good working relationships amongst members of the help desk team to ensure smooth flow of work, which improves overall performance.
- Develop several strategies to tackle issues to have a backup plan where a particular strategy might not be effective.
- Handle escalated issues: Serve as an escalation point for Tier 1 support, resolving more complex hardware, software, and network problems.
- Provide advanced troubleshooting: Diagnose and resolve problems that require detailed system and application knowledge, such as system performance issues or network connectivity issues.
- Document solutions: Maintain a knowledge base by documenting solutions to complex problems to assist both users and other support staff.
- Collaborate with other teams: Work with service desk providers and internal field Services team on advanced troubleshooting and to implement solutions.
- Collaborate with Clients: Engage with clients to drive remote resolution and problem determination. Ability to verbally walk people through resolution steps.
- Support system maintenance: Assist with tasks like equipment testing, new system and software trials, and maintaining asset logs.
- Mentor junior technicians: Provide guidance and assistance to Help Desk Level 1 technicians.
